Capacity Credit Term definition

Capacity Credit Term has the meaning specified in Section 2.2(a).
Capacity Credit Term means the period of time in respect of which Seller and Buyer are obligated to sell and purchase Capacity Credits, in accordance with the terms hereof, as determined according to Section 2.1 and Section 2.2(b).
Capacity Credit Term means the period of time in respect of which Seller and Buyer are obligated to sell and purchase Capacity Credits.

Examples of Capacity Credit Term in a sentence

  • The Parties acknowledge the possibility that a change in Law (including in the interpretation thereof) may occur that requires or will require one or both of the Parties to incur additional costs during the Capacity Credit Term beyond those projected to be incurred by such Party as of the Effective Date.

  • Subject to the other terms hereof, including Section 4.2, for each calendar month of a given Planning Period during the Capacity Credit Term, Buyer shall pay to Seller the Monthly Payment determined in accordance with Schedule 4.1 for Capacity Credits delivered to Buyer for such month up to the applicable Contract Quantity.

  • Notwithstanding anything to the contrary herein or in the Confidentiality Agreement, Buyer shall be entitled to disclose to any Governmental Authority as a matter of right, without seeking any confidential treatment therefor, Seller’s name, the Capacity Credit Term, the type, nature, and a general description of the Transaction, and amount and type of capacity credits under contract pursuant to this Agreement.
